1. Can I use low-fat or fat-free Greek yogurt?
Yes, but the texture will be less creamy. Full-fat Greek yogurt is best for richness.
2. How long does homemade no-churn ice cream last in the freezer?
It’s best enjoyed within 1–2 weeks. After that, texture may degrade.
3. Can I add protein powder to these recipes?
Definitely! Use an unflavored or vanilla protein powder and mix it into the base before freezing.
4. Is this ice cream vegan-friendly?
Some recipes are! Use coconut yogurt and plant-based milk in place of dairy for a vegan version.
5. Can I skip stirring during freezing?
You can, but stirring improves texture and prevents ice crystals. It’s worth the extra effort.
